Facilities ticket — Night shift, Brindlecote Campus. Twenty-two interns from the Fennhollow programme arrive tomorrow at 08:00. Please unlock seminar rooms B2 and B3 by 06:30, set chairs to classroom layout, and confirm the water coolers on level one are refilled. Leave the loading bay clear for their equipment van. Overnight access to the prep corridor requires the pass code below.

badge for bajop-yawep: bdg-NNHEW-6

Team — the Merrowfield dedupe pass for customer records ships tonight. New contractors: do not run the merge script against staging until the fuzzy-match thresholds land. Duplicates are soft-linked first, hard-merged after 48h review. Flag anything odd in the release channel. Verification was run against the build referenced below.

pipeline stamp: htk9_ce63042d9

Ticket: Turnstile counter drift at Ferrowick Arena. Gate C counters diverge from the Tallyspan dashboard by ~3% after each event. Suspect the edge node was redeployed with stale settings and never re-synced. Please diff the running config against source control and reconcile before Saturday's match. The values currently deployed on the Gate C node are as follows.

settings of tagef-bawif:
DRUIX_HOST=druix.zemvarlabs.internal
DRUIX_PORT=8000

Handover — Katalox cache invalidation. Dario: the catalog invalidation worker on Katalox keeps lagging after bulk price imports. I bumped the fanout batch size and shortened TTLs on the hot SKU tier. If stale prices show up, flush the regional edge layer first, not the origin. Don't restart the worker mid-import. Current service settings are below.

settings of yahif-kahip:
[druwyn]
port = 9300
region = upper-2
host = druwyn.qorvelworks.internal
timeout_ms = 1000
retries = 3

Finance Review Summary — Currency Hedging

For heads of department: After reviewing exposure from the Avenor contract, payable in Suldenian crowns, Treasury recommends hedging 70% of forecast receipts via twelve-month forwards. Unhedged residual stays within board-approved limits. Costs were modelled against three rate scenarios by the Pellwright desk. The strategic rationale for this position is summarized in the confidential note below.

management briefing: The renewal with Zoraelax Group closes at $10 million a year, 15 percent below the last contract. Project Ralael slips by six weeks because of the audit delay.